
The question of what old chicken smells like is both intriguing and important, as it directly relates to food safety and sensory perception. When chicken ages beyond its prime, it undergoes chemical changes that alter its aroma, often emitting a distinct, unpleasant odor. This smell is typically described as sour, sulfurous, or akin to ammonia, signaling the breakdown of proteins and the growth of bacteria. Recognizing this scent is crucial, as consuming spoiled chicken can lead to foodborne illnesses. Understanding the characteristics of this odor not only helps in identifying unsafe food but also highlights the importance of proper storage and handling to maintain freshness.

Common Odor Descriptions: Sour, ammonia-like, or sulfuric smells indicate spoilage in old chicken
The nose knows when chicken has gone bad, and certain odors are dead giveaways. Among these, sour, ammonia-like, or sulfuric smells are the most common indicators of spoilage. These smells arise from the breakdown of proteins and the growth of bacteria, which produce volatile compounds like hydrogen sulfide and ammonia. If your chicken emits any of these odors, it’s a clear sign to discard it immediately, as consuming spoiled poultry can lead to foodborne illnesses such as salmonella or campylobacter.
Analyzing these odors can help you understand the chemistry behind spoilage. A sour smell, akin to spoiled milk or vinegar, is often the first sign of bacterial activity. This occurs as bacteria ferment sugars in the meat, producing lactic acid. Ammonia-like odors, on the other hand, are more advanced indicators of decomposition. They result from the breakdown of proteins into amino acids, which release ammonia as a byproduct. Sulfuric smells, reminiscent of rotten eggs, are caused by hydrogen sulfide gas produced by certain bacteria. Recognizing these distinctions can help you pinpoint the stage of spoilage and act accordingly.
From a practical standpoint, here’s how to handle chicken with these odors: First, trust your senses. If the smell is faintly off, cook the chicken to an internal temperature of 165°F (74°C) to kill bacteria, but be aware that toxins produced by certain bacteria (like *Staphylococcus aureus*) are heat-stable and won’t be destroyed by cooking. However, if the odor is strong and unmistakably sour, ammonia-like, or sulfuric, discard the chicken without hesitation. Store raw chicken in the refrigerator for no more than 1–2 days or freeze it for up to 9 months to prevent spoilage. Always use airtight containers or vacuum-sealed bags to minimize exposure to air, which accelerates bacterial growth.
Comparing these odors to other spoiled foods can provide additional context. While sour smells are common in dairy and fermented products, their presence in chicken is always a red flag. Ammonia-like odors are less common in other meats but are a hallmark of spoiled poultry. Sulfuric smells, though present in rotten eggs, are rarer in chicken but equally alarming. This comparison underscores the importance of treating these odors in chicken as unique and urgent warnings.
In conclusion, sour, ammonia-like, or sulfuric smells are not just unpleasant—they are critical indicators of chicken spoilage. By understanding their origins and implications, you can make informed decisions to protect your health. Always prioritize food safety, and when in doubt, throw it out. Proper storage and timely consumption are your best defenses against these telltale odors.

Fresh vs. Spoiled Aroma: Fresh chicken smells neutral; spoiled chicken has a strong, unpleasant odor
Fresh chicken, when properly handled, emits a subtle, almost imperceptible scent that is neither off-putting nor overpowering. This neutral aroma is a hallmark of quality and safety, indicating that the meat is free from bacterial growth and spoilage. The absence of a strong smell is not a flaw but a feature, as it signifies that the chicken has been processed and stored correctly. For instance, a freshly butchered chicken will have a clean, faintly metallic smell, which dissipates quickly when exposed to air. This is a reliable indicator that the chicken is safe for consumption and will cook into a delicious meal.
In contrast, spoiled chicken announces its presence with a pungent, sulfurous odor that is impossible to ignore. This smell, often described as "sour" or "ammonia-like," is a red flag signaling the presence of harmful bacteria such as Salmonella or E. coli. The intensity of the odor correlates with the degree of spoilage; a mildly off-putting smell may indicate the chicken is past its prime but not yet dangerous, while a strong, putrid stench means it should be discarded immediately. For example, if a chicken left in the refrigerator for over two days begins to emit a sharp, unpleasant smell, it’s a clear warning to avoid cooking or consuming it.
To distinguish between fresh and spoiled chicken, trust your sense of smell as a primary tool. Fresh chicken should smell like nothing at all, or at most, have a faint, clean scent. Spoiled chicken, however, will assault your nostrils with an unmistakable, unpleasant odor. A practical tip is to perform a "sniff test" before cooking: if the chicken smells off, err on the side of caution and dispose of it. Additionally, always check the expiration date and storage conditions, as these factors significantly influence the chicken’s freshness.
The science behind these aromas lies in the breakdown of proteins and the growth of bacteria. Fresh chicken’s neutral smell is due to its intact cellular structure, while spoiled chicken’s odor arises from the release of volatile compounds like hydrogen sulfide and ammonia during bacterial decomposition. Understanding this process underscores the importance of proper storage—keeping chicken at or below 40°F (4°C) slows bacterial growth and preserves its freshness. Conversely, leaving chicken at room temperature for more than two hours accelerates spoilage, making it a breeding ground for harmful pathogens.
In summary, the difference between fresh and spoiled chicken is as clear as its aroma. A neutral or faintly clean scent indicates safety and quality, while a strong, unpleasant odor is a definitive sign of spoilage. By relying on your sense of smell and adhering to proper storage practices, you can ensure that the chicken you cook is not only delicious but also safe to eat. Remember, when in doubt, throw it out—it’s always better to be cautious than risk foodborne illness.

Health Risks of Smell: Bad odor signals bacteria growth, making consumption potentially harmful
A putrid, sour odor wafting from chicken is a red flag, signaling potential bacterial contamination. This isn't just an unpleasant sensory experience; it's a warning sign from your body, urging you to discard the meat. Bacteria like Salmonella and Campylobacter, common culprits in foodborne illnesses, thrive in protein-rich environments like poultry. As they multiply, they produce volatile compounds with distinct, unpleasant smells. Think of it as their calling card, a pungent announcement of their presence.
Ignoring this olfactory warning can have serious consequences. Consuming chicken harboring these bacteria can lead to food poisoning, characterized by nausea, vomiting, diarrhea, and abdominal cramps. In severe cases, especially for young children, the elderly, and individuals with weakened immune systems, complications like dehydration and even hospitalization can occur.
The "sniff test" is a simple yet effective tool in your food safety arsenal. If chicken emits an off-putting odor, resembling rotten eggs, ammonia, or a general "sour" smell, discard it immediately. Don't rely solely on expiration dates; they are guidelines, not guarantees. Trust your senses. Cooking contaminated chicken to a safe internal temperature (165°F/74°C) might kill the bacteria, but the toxins they produce can remain, still causing illness.
While the smell test is crucial, it's not foolproof. Some bacterial strains produce fewer odor-causing compounds. Therefore, proper food handling practices are paramount. Store chicken at or below 40°F (4°C), cook it thoroughly, and avoid cross-contamination with other foods. Remember, when in doubt, throw it out. Your health is worth more than a questionable meal.

Storage Impact on Smell: Improper storage accelerates odor development in aging chicken
Improper storage of chicken can turn a mild, almost undetectable scent into an overpowering odor within days. Refrigerated chicken, when stored above 40°F (4°C), enters the "danger zone" where bacteria thrive, producing volatile compounds like sulfur dioxide and ammonia. These compounds are the culprits behind the sharp, acrid smell often described as "sour" or "rotten eggs." For instance, *Salmonella* and *Campylobacter*—common poultry pathogens—multiply rapidly at these temperatures, accelerating decomposition and odor development. The takeaway? Always store raw chicken in the coldest part of the fridge, ideally at 32°F (0°C), and use airtight containers to minimize exposure to air.
Consider the contrast between properly and improperly stored chicken. A whole chicken stored correctly in the fridge for 1-2 days retains a neutral, slightly metallic scent, typical of fresh poultry. However, the same chicken left unwrapped on a countertop for 6 hours develops a faintly sweet, off-putting aroma within 24 hours. This sweetness is due to the breakdown of proteins into amino acids like methionine, which bacteria metabolize into smelly byproducts. Freezing, on the other hand, halts this process almost entirely, preserving the chicken’s original smell for up to 12 months if stored at 0°F (-18°C). The lesson here is clear: time and temperature are enemies of freshness, and proper storage is non-negotiable.
For those who’ve ever wondered why old chicken smells "fishy," the answer lies in improper storage conditions. When chicken is exposed to moisture—whether from leaky packaging or high humidity—enzymes like lipase break down fats into fatty acids, producing a smell reminiscent of spoiled seafood. This is exacerbated in vacuum-sealed packages that trap moisture, creating an ideal environment for bacterial growth. To prevent this, pat chicken dry before storing, use paper towels to absorb excess moisture, and opt for breathable packaging like butcher paper over plastic wrap. Even small adjustments, like placing a dry cloth beneath the chicken in the fridge, can significantly reduce odor development.
Finally, let’s address the freezer burn myth. While freezer-burned chicken is safe to eat, its smell and texture are compromised due to dehydration and oxidation. The telltale signs—grayish patches and a faint ammonia odor—result from air exposure, not bacterial growth. To avoid this, wrap chicken tightly in heavy-duty aluminum foil or use vacuum-sealed bags, removing as much air as possible. Label packages with the storage date, as chicken stored beyond 6 months may develop off-flavors even if it remains technically edible. Proper storage isn’t just about safety—it’s about preserving quality, ensuring that your chicken smells as it should when you’re ready to cook.

Cooking Old Chicken: Cooking may mask smell but doesn’t eliminate health risks from spoilage
Old chicken often emits a sour, ammonia-like odor, a stark contrast to its fresh, neutral scent. This smell signals bacterial growth, primarily from organisms like Salmonella and Campylobacter, which thrive as the meat spoils. Cooking can indeed mask this off-putting aroma by breaking down some of the volatile compounds responsible for it. However, heat does not neutralize the toxins produced by these bacteria, such as those from *Clostridium perfringens* or *Staphylococcus aureus*. Consuming chicken in this state can lead to foodborne illnesses, with symptoms ranging from mild gastrointestinal discomfort to severe dehydration or even hospitalization in vulnerable populations like children, the elderly, or immunocompromised individuals.
Consider this scenario: you discover a forgotten package of chicken in the refrigerator, its "use-by" date long past. Upon opening, a faint but unmistakable tang fills the air. Instinct might prompt you to cook it thoroughly, thinking heat will render it safe. While cooking to an internal temperature of 165°F (74°C) kills active bacteria, it does nothing to eliminate pre-formed toxins, which are heat-stable. For instance, *Staphylococcus aureus* produces enterotoxins that withstand boiling temperatures, making the chicken hazardous regardless of its apparent doneness. The USDA explicitly advises against consuming meat with a suspicious odor, emphasizing that sensory cues like smell are often more reliable than visual inspection alone.
From a practical standpoint, preventing spoilage is far more effective than attempting to salvage questionable chicken. Store raw poultry at or below 40°F (4°C) and use it within 1–2 days of purchase, or freeze it for up to 9 months. If in doubt, err on the side of caution: discard chicken with an off smell, slimy texture, or discoloration. Marinades or heavy seasoning might temporarily disguise these signs, but they do not address the underlying health risks. Investing in a meat thermometer and adhering to proper storage guidelines are simple yet critical steps to avoid the pitfalls of relying on cooking as a cure-all for spoiled food.
The takeaway is clear: cooking old chicken may render it palatable by reducing odors, but it does not make it safe. Bacterial toxins remain a threat, and no amount of heat or seasoning can reverse spoilage. Prioritize prevention through mindful storage and timely consumption, and trust your senses when assessing freshness. In the kitchen, caution trumps creativity—especially when health is on the line.
